Sugar-Free Whole Wheat Peanut Butter Cookies

Description:
Adapted from a cherished recipe in the Mennonite Community Cookbook, this delightful cookie recipe has been tailored to offer a healthier twist on the traditional treat. By substituting sugar with Splenda and white flour with wholesome whole wheat flour, these cookies maintain their classic flavor while keeping your blood sugar levels in check. Perfect for those who are looking for a sweet indulgence without the sugar rush, these cookies are a great addition to your baking repertoire.

Prep Time: 30 minutes
Cook Time: 15 minutes
Total Time: 45 minutes
Yield: Approximately 4 dozen cookies

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up shortening
  • 1 cup peanut butter
  • 1 1/2 to 2 cups Splenda sugar substitute (to taste)
  • 2 large eggs
  • 3 cups whole wheat flour
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 2 teaspoons ba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Instructions:

  1. Cream the Shortening and Peanut Butter:
    Begin by placing the shortening and peanut butter in a microwave-safe bowl. Heat the mixture in the microwave for 30 seconds to soften, making it easier to blend. Stir until well combined.

  2. Add Splenda and Continue Creaming:
    To the softened mixture, add the Splenda sugar substitute. Beat the ingredients together until smooth and creamy.

  3. Incorporate Eggs and Vanilla:
    Add the e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Stir in the vanilla extract until the mixture is fully combined.

  4. Combine Dry Ingredients:
    In a separate bowl, sift together the whole wheat flour, salt, baking soda, and baking powder. This helps to ensure an even distribution of the leavening agents and salt.

  5. Mix Dry Ingredients into the Wet Mixture:
    Gradually add the dry ingredients to the creamed mixture. Stir thoroughly until the dough begins to come together. The mixture will be somewhat crumbly but should hold together when pressed with your hands.

  6. Optional – Chill Dough:
    For better handling, you may choose to chill the dough in the refrigerator for several hours. This step can help the dough firm up, making it easier to shape.

  7. Shape and Bake:
    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). If you chilled the dough, allow it to sit at room temperature for a few minutes to soften slightly. Shape the dough into balls about 1 inch in diameter and place them evenly spaced on a cookie sheet. Use a fork to press each ball flat, creating a classic crisscross pattern on the top.

  8. Bake:
    Bake in the preheated oven for 12 to 15 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own. The centers may appear slightly soft, but they will firm up as the cookies cool.

  9. Cool and Enjoy:
    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. Enjoy your healthier version of peanut butter cookies with a cup of tea or coffee!
